Job Description

Key Responsibilities

Strategic Leadership and Innovation

  • Lead the evolution from MEAL to METAL, embedding technology and innovation at the core of IRC Kenya’s evidence and learning systems.
  • Ensure the country program’s measurement and learning agenda aligns with IRC’s Strategy100 and Kenya’s Strategic Action Plan (SAP).
  • Champion the use of data-driven and technology-enabled decision-making, ensuring that insights from data are translated into adaptive programming.
  • Champion client centered design approaches into our sectoral strategies and critical proposals
  • Lead and enhance outcome level analysis for the purposes of evidence driven programming throughout the strategic plan cycle
  • Lead independent research, learning and evaluation to position IRC as a thought leader in its core sectors
  • Cultivate and manage strategic research and learning partnerships with universities, research institutions, and innovation labs to enhance evidence generation and thought leadership.
  • Represent IRC Kenya in national and regional research, M&E, and innovation forums.
  • Embed client accountability, inclusivity, and data ethics across all technology and learning initiatives.

Technological Leadership and Data Systems

  • Lead the design and deployment of digital data systems and ensure interoperability across programs and platforms.
  • Promote advanced analytics and data visualization (using Power BI, Tableau, and GIS) to strengthen strategic insights, outcome-level analysis, and operational efficiency.
  • Integrate AI and automation tools into data collection, cleaning, and interpretation processes where appropriate and ethical.
  • Oversee data quality assurance and lead data audits to ensure validity, reliability, and compliance with IRC standards.
  • Strengthen the use of digital feedback and client-responsive systems to ensure accountability and real-time program adaptation.

Research, Evidence, and Learning

  • Lead the country program’s research and learning agenda, ensuring all studies and evaluations meet high methodological standards.
  • Commission and manage independent and collaborative studies that assess program outcomes and explore emerging humanitarian and development questions.
  • Translate research and evaluation findings into strategic recommendations, publications, and advocacy products.
  • Facilitate learning events, brown-bag discussions, and peer-to-peer exchanges to ensure knowledge sharing and institutional learning.
  • Ensure evidence is systematically used to inform proposal development, strategy updates, and innovation design.

Capacity Strengthening and Team Leadership

  • Provide strategic direction and mentorship to the national MEAL teams, fostering a culture of curiosity, innovation, and excellence.
  • Conduct regular capacity assessments and develop learning pathways for IRC and partner MEAL staff.
  • Build technical capacity in digital data systems, statistical analysis, AI-supported analytics, and visualization.
  • Lead recruitment, supervision, and professional development of METAL team members, ensuring a diverse and high-performing unit.

Key Working Relationships

  • Reports to: Deputy Director for Grants and Accountability (DDGA)
  • Direct Supervision: MEAL Technology Manager, Client Responsiveness Manager
  • Internal: Program Coordinators and Managers, Regional Measurement Advisors, Grants, Finance, and Technical Coordinators
  • External: Universities, research institutions, government counterparts, partner NGOs, and innovation collaborators

Qualifications and Experience

  • Advanced degree in data science, statistics, public health, social sciences, information systems, or a related field.
  • Minimum 6–8 years of experience in Monitoring, Evaluation, Accountability, and Learning in humanitarian or development contexts, including at least 3 years in a leadership capacity.
  • Demonstrated experience in research design, implementation, and dissemination, including collaboration with academic or research institutions.
  • Proven expertise in data management systems, mobile data collection platforms (CommCare, ODK), and data visualization tools (Power BI, Tableau).
  • Understanding and experience with AI, machine learning, or digital transformation tools applied to M&E, learning, or operational efficiency is highly desirable.
  • Strong understanding of client accountability mechanisms and participatory approaches.
  • Excellent interpersonal, presentation, and leadership skills, with the ability to manage multidisciplinary teams and cross-sector collaboration.
  • Ability and willingness to travel to field locations as needed.
  • Fluency in English required; Kiswahili proficiency is an asset.
